    Default Turning on WYSIWYG Text Editor

    Some of you have asked how to hyperlink, and do other 'text' based operations in the Fourms. It didn't occur to me until today, but many of you probably have not turned on this option! The Forums have a WYSIWYG Text editor, which must be set by each user.

    Go to Control Panel link (in the gray menu bar above the posts, on the left.)
    Then click on Edit Options
    On the Options screen, scroll to the bottom to Miscellaneous Options
    For the Message Editor Interface, change the pull-down to Enhanced Interface - Full WYSIWYG Editing
    Click Save Changes buttom at the bottom.
    Now your Text Editor should have a set of buttons along the top of the text window.
